ROG STRIX X870-A GAMING WIFI and 9100 Pro 8TB compatibility

luckypanda
Level 7

I want to consolidate all of my games onto one SSD because I want to install linux on it's own drive, but when I looked at the support list for the motherboard it's showing that all of the other versions (1-4TB) are supported but the 8TB one is not listed. Why is that the only one that isn't listed? I don't have room to add another storage device unfortunately due to the shared bandwidth.

Probably because the 8Tb-version didn't exist yet when they released the motherboard, or haven't updated the support list since it came out recently. I'd say you've got a big chance the 8Tb works just as well as the other capacities do. 😉

you can use a gen 4 ssd in slot 4 and it will not interfere with the pcie lanes of gpu. as regards the 9100 pro. give it time to update
